Output 8ed24f328175b36f06e3849ae1922e75032239548e44a093fce607d1cfdf0f6d:6

value
9500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e149ecfbd1ac58baf0703c96ab56e1ebee5a6cb8 OP_EQUALVERIFY OP_CHECKSIG
address
DRgK8sNBDW7jUmCP3hmc16NUeY4xh1yqV6
transaction
8ed24f328175b36f06e3849ae1922e75032239548e44a093fce607d1cfdf0f6d